Abstract

Members of the MAP kinase family are implicated in the activation of a wide variety of transcription factors and proteins involved in the control of cytokine production. A pair of novel protein kinase homologues (p38) involved in the regulation of cytokine synthesis have been described. 1 Small molecule inhibitors of p38, such as SB 203580 1 2 and 3 (Fig. 1), can potentially lead to the treatment of osteoporosis and inflammatory disorders. ...
